I remember the early days after my baby made her arrival. That exhausting, milky oblivion. The wonder. The inexplainable love and magic. The overwhelming chaos in which time stood still.
In the midst of being tired beyond comprehension, I was supposed to remember when my baby ate last and what color her poop was and if I fed her on my left or right. The hospital checked us out with a “feeding chart” on colored paper, but the record-keeping wreaked havoc on an already-enormous workload.
It would have been so wonderful to have an itzbeen in those days - to tell us exactly how long it had been since we fed or changed our baby. This little gadget is extremely clever. It features a clock, a nightlight, a L/R switch, and little buttons for you to push to track when baby was fed, changed, or napped last. It even allows you to set a “reminder alarm” for each timer - no more waking up in a sweat with “Was the baby supposed to have eaten by now?” on your mind.
Best of all, the itzbeen is just under $26 so it won’t break the bank. And it can grow with you too. I still keep it by my daughter’s bedside so I can check the time or turn on the little nightlight during night wakings. And some parents report using it to monitor TV time or to aid in the potty training process as well.
